Új hozzászólás Aktív témák

  • RCH663

    aktív tag

    Házi feladat:

    Hogyan lehet egy thread szálat meggyőzni arról, hogy ha 100%-ra terheli a saját proci magját akkor egy alapból üresen járó magot kezdjen el terhelni. Valahol a win7-ben lesz a megoldás, de nem jutok előbbre.

    Lényege a dolognak:

    FSX multi core kódja úgy van megírva, hogy a core0 a main thread (amíg el nem pakoljuk onnan), ami ha kikoppan 100%-ra akkor nem kezdi átrakni a szálat egy másik kevésbé terhelt magra, hanem konstatálja hogy itt a cpu limit, és elégedetten hátra dől, a többi mag meg jó ha 20%-on ketyeg.

    Valahogy meg kiellene oldani, hogy main thread-nek két magot adjunk, és egy csapásra feltehetően kb 30-40%-al meg tudnánk dobni az FSX teljesítményét azonos vason.

    Dőljenek az ötletek, biztos hogy ki lehet cselezni valahogy.

Új hozzászólás Aktív témák